Misinformation abounds when it comes to (not) paying taxes. People who make money from the „gig” or „sharing” economy are often confused. They can earn money on sites like Fiverr,
, Lyft, Airbnb or directly from language schools or boarders. They can do marketing, accounting, UX design, charge rideshare scooters overnight and many more paid tasks.
